Subject: [PATCH] mmc: mmcif: remove obsolete support for sh7372
Date: Tue, 26 Apr 2016 22:34:46 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1461702886-6873-1-git-send-email-wsa@the-dreams.de> (raw)

From: Wolfram Sang <wsa+renesas@sang-engineering.com>

There is no support for this platform in the kernel anymore. Make the
Kconfig text more generic, so it won't get stale anymore.

Reported-by: Geert Uytterhoeven <geert+renesas@glider.be>
Signed-off-by: Wolfram Sang <wsa+renesas@sang-engineering.com>
---
 drivers/mmc/host/Kconfig |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/mmc/host/Kconfig b/drivers/mmc/host/Kconfig
index 04feea8354cba7..f5be219274329d 100644
--- a/drivers/mmc/host/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/mmc/host/Kconfig
@@ -676,9 +676,9 @@ config MMC_SH_MMCIF
 	depends on HAS_DMA
 	depends on SUPERH || ARCH_RENESAS || COMPILE_TEST
 	help
-	  This selects the MMC Host Interface controller (MMCIF).
+	  This selects the MMC Host Interface controller (MMCIF) found in various
+	  Renesas SoCs for SH and ARM architectures.
 
-	  This driver supports MMCIF in sh7724/sh7757/sh7372.
 
 config MMC_JZ4740
 	tristate "JZ4740 SD/Multimedia Card Interface support"
-- 
2.7.0
